- /* When calling functions on Irix 5 (or any MIPS SVR4 ABI compliant
- platform) $25 must hold the function address. Dest_Reg is a macro
- used in CALL_DUMMY in tm-mips.h. */
- #undef Dest_Reg
- #define Dest_Reg 25
-
- /* The signal handler trampoline is called _sigtramp. */
- #undef IN_SIGTRAMP
- #define IN_SIGTRAMP(pc, name) ((name) && STREQ ("_sigtramp", name))
-
- /* Irix 5 saves a full 64 bits for each register. We skip 2 * 4 to
- get to the saved PC (the register mask and status register are both
- 32 bits) and then another 4 to get to the lower 32 bits. We skip
- the same 4 bytes, plus the 8 bytes for the PC to get to the
- registers, and add another 4 to get to the lower 32 bits. We skip
- 8 bytes per register. */
- #undef SIGFRAME_PC_OFF
- #define SIGFRAME_PC_OFF (SIGFRAME_BASE + 2 * 4 + 4)
- #undef SIGFRAME_REGSAVE_OFF
- #define SIGFRAME_REGSAVE_OFF (SIGFRAME_BASE + 2 * 4 + 8 + 4)
- #define SIGFRAME_REG_SIZE 8
